On 02-Oct-2001 SZALAY Attila wrote:
Hi All!
Hi!
Egy konkret, amde kisse bonyolultabb pelda:
class MyPop3sProxy(PsslProxy): ...
Ez egyebkent egy feloldalas Pop3s proxy, azaz a kliens oldalan pop3s mig a szerver-nek semmit nem kell tudnia az ssl-rol. Ezen kivul csak es kizarolag a kiscsibe user-t engedjuk be, es neki sem engedjuk meg a level torleset.
Mas szoval zorp-nal, mint applikacios szintu proxy-nal majd minden parancsrol eldonthetjuk, hogy atmehet-e vagy nem. Raadasul, mivel itt egy programozasi nyelv all a rendelkezesunkre, nem vagyunk kiszolgaltatva az epp aktualis adatoknak sem. (Azaz felhasznalhatunk korabbi adatokat, vagy eppen rendszeren kivuli adatokat is, mint pl. az aktualis ido, a gep terheltsege, stb.)
Erre pelda a kovetkezo felallas. Feladat, hogy user nem torolheti le a levelet olvasatlanul. (Legalabbis a pop3 szerverrol le kell toltenie a sajat gepere, mielott a szerveren torolne.) Nezzuk hogyan oldhatjuk ezt meg zorp alatt:
class MyPop3(Pop3Proxy): ...
Nem egyszeru a konfiguralasa... :( Kicsit bonyolultra sikerult, persze ez az en problemam... :) Valami magyar doksi kellene, ahol a parancsok listaja bent van. Ha mar magyar a progi... :)
Vagyis csinalunk egy tombot, es ennek a tombnek a megfelelo elemenek a valtoztatasaval jelezzuk, ha azt a levelet letoltottek, es csak ebben az esetben engedjuk a torleset.
De megemlithetnem peldanak az egyszeru URL szurest is.
Vagy pl. azt, hogy csinalhatunk (pontosabban keszen kapunk) olyan Ftp proxyt, ami pl. csak letoltest, mas esetben csak feltoltest engedelyezi.
Vagy pl. megemlithetem, hogy ftp eseten tud valtani passziv es aktiv kapcsolat kozott ugy, hogy pl. kifele csak aktiv _latszik_.
Mi is a kulonbseg az aktiv es a passziv ftp kozott? THanx! Bye!